Surrey lifted the Girls U18 County One Day Knockout Cup yesterday, beating Yorkshire by 105 runs at Kibworth CC.

Opener Jemima Bowman was the star of the final, scoring a spectacular 142 off 128 balls, taking Surrey to a formidable 317/7 from their 50 overs, after the Three Feathers were inserted to bat.

Bowman received admirable support from her fellow opener Ivreen Dhaliwal (27) and wicketkeeper Hannah Burridge (51). A late cameo from Rosie Foster (29*) pushed Surrey past the 300 mark.

Bowman, at once anchoring the innings while also going well above a run a ball, shared stands of 78, 113 and 66 with Dhaliwal, Burridge, and Millie Ayling respectively.

With a big total to defend, the bowlers came out firing, with Flora Rogers (4/42) leading the charge. Daisy Perry (2/30), Libby Thabrew (2/41), and Rebecca Denman (1/36) were also among the wickets as Surrey bowled out Yorkshire for 212.

Amelia Oliver was the pick of the batters for the White Rose, notching up 84, and Amelia Love bowled well for her 2/38.
